Romualdo Cave
Cave
Romuald's Cave is a cave in the western part of Istria County, Croatia, that contains the oldest known cave paintings in southeast Europe, as well as traces of both animal and human Upper Paleolithic habitation. Romualdo Cave is situated 380 metres northwest of Sv. Martin.
